To connect to a remote computer from File Server Resource Manager
  1. In Administrative Tools, click File Server Resource Manager.
  2. In the console tree, right-click File Server Resource Manager, and then click Connect to Another Computer.
  3. In the Connect to Another Computer dialog box, click Another computer. ...
  4. Click OK.

How are remote file systems implemented?

Remote file systems are implemented by a collection of software components. The number and complexity of the software components required varies based on the design and complexity of the remote file system.

What file access is included with Microsoft Host Integration Server 2000?

IBM mainframe VSAM and AS/400 file access, included with Microsoft Host Integration Server 2000

What is software on a server?

Software on the server system implements the remote file server operations that access local file storage or resources on the server. Requests are received from client network redirectors that are processed on the file server, and the responses are sent back to the client.

What is a client software?

This client software functions as a "network redirector" forwarding local calls for file operations to some remote server. This network redirector makes the remote resources appear as if they are local.

Can a system be both a client and a server?

A system can act as both a client to some systems and as a server to other clients. So, it is common to find both client and server software running on a single system.

What is FTP server?

FTP Server. FTP (File Transfer Protocol) is partially similar to VPNs where you install them on your home computer and grant access to it from the Internet. Normally FTP is unencrypted, which means people can easily monitor your files in transit and spoof your passwords.

What is a NAS box?

A NAS is a mini remote file server that connects to a home network. They're great for file sharing and backups for multiple computers, and they typically offer remote file access over FTP or a web browser, depending on the device. Popular NAS boxes that provide access to files remotely include Buffalo Linkstation and Apple Time Capsule.

What is an online backup service?

Online backup services provide automatic offsite storage of files and typically allow you to download individual files from a web browser or mobile app. Carbonite, Mozy, CrashPlan, and BackBlaze are a few to consider.

What device to use to access shared files?

If you don't need to remotely control or manage your home computer and only want to access shared files over the internet, use a Network Attached Storage (NAS) device.

Is it better to use an external hard drive or a dedicated NAS?

Because external hard drives can come in large sizes, it's easy to instantly provide terabytes of storage for remote access. Using an external hard drive connected to a router is slower than a dedicated NAS, but this option may be less expensive if you have an external drive or compatible router.
